1. Compliance Comes First
Arguably the most important feature of any cannabis POS system is real-time compliance tracking. Regulations in this industry are strict and ever-changing. Whether it’s seed-to-sale tracking, automatic reporting to Metrc or BioTrack, or ID verification for age-restricted sales, the system must ensure that your dispensary remains compliant with both state and local laws — without slowing down your workflow.
The best POS platforms automate these requirements, reducing the risk of human error while helping dispensary staff stay focused on customers instead of paperwork.
2. Inventory Management with Precision
In cannabis retail, inventory control is not just a best practice — it’s a legal requirement. A top-tier POS system will offer robust inventory tracking features that keep tabs on every gram, unit, or edible that enters and exits the store.
Look for features like real-time syncing between the POS and back office, automatic product categorization, low-stock alerts, and barcode scanning. These tools help reduce shrinkage, streamline audits, and ensure your inventory is always compliant and ready for sale.
3. Customer Experience and Loyalty Tools
The modern dispensary shopper expects more than just a quick checkout — they want a personalized, engaging retail experience. That’s where loyalty programs, text/email marketing integration, and smart customer profiles come into play.
A great POS system will allow staff to track preferences, reward repeat purchases, and offer targeted promotions to keep customers coming back. Integration with CRM tools or in-house loyalty apps can make all the difference when building brand loyalty in a competitive market.
4. Ease of Use and Training Time
Let’s face it — cannabis retail can get busy fast. Your team needs a POS interface that’s intuitive, efficient, and easy to train on. The best systems are designed with the budtender in mind: simple navigation, customizable dashboards, and fast response times at checkout.
This not only improves the customer experience but also boosts employee morale and reduces training costs.
5. Scalability and Integration
Whether you’re a single-location shop or a multi-state operator (MSO), your POS system should grow with you. Scalability means being able to handle more SKUs, more customers, and more stores — without crashing or bogging down performance.
It should also integrate smoothly with other software: e-commerce platforms, accounting tools, delivery apps, and marketing platforms. The more your systems “talk” to each other, the more efficiently your operation can run.
